Love to work outdoors? A Certificate III in Agriculture AHC30116 is a great way to gain in-demand skills around Australia. Help secure a sustainable future for a growing population with practical skills in livestock breeding, crop harvesting and establishing pastures.

From biology and chemistry to geology and pedology, studying a Certificate III in Agriculture AHC30122 means you touch on multiple disciplines in a practical way. You’ll learn how to operate machinery like tractors and skid steers, as well as develop a deep understanding of best practice in farm operations.
